About the role We are looking for a heavy Vehicle Foreman to join our team in a full-time capacity at our state-of-the-art dealership facility in Somerton. Reporting directly to the Workshop Manager, you will collaborate closely with the team, overseeing a sizable workshop of skilled technicians and eager apprentices. This role is responsible for ensuring the smooth and efficient management of daily workflows with accuracy and precision.
